This is a practical physics question involving setting up circuits and taking measurements to determine resistance. Since no numerical values are provided, I will outline the steps for each instruction.
a) (i) Determine the diameters and of the wires A and B respectively. Step 1: Use the micrometer screw gauge to measure the diameter of wire A at several different points along its length. Step 2: Calculate the average diameter for wire A, which will be . Step 3: Repeat the process for wire B to find its average diameter, .
(ii) Evaluate . Step 1: Substitute the measured average diameters and into the given formula. Step 2: Calculate the ratio and then square the result to find the value of .
(iii) Set up the circuit with wire A as shown in Fig. 3(a). Step 1: Connect the battery (E), key (K), rheostat (), and ammeter (A) in series with wire A. Step 2: Connect the voltmeter (V) in parallel across wire A. Ensure correct polarity for all meters.
(iv) Close the key. Step 1: Insert the plug into the key (K) to complete the circuit. This allows current to flow.
(v) Adjust the rheostat to obtain the minimum value of current . Step 1: Slide the rheostat's contact to the position that offers the maximum resistance. This will result in the minimum current flowing through the circuit.
(vi) Read and record and the corresponding voltmeter reading . Step 1: Read the value displayed on the ammeter and record it as . Step 2: Read the value displayed on the voltmeter and record it as .
(vii) Adjust the rheostat steadily to obtain five other values of current . Step 1: Gradually decrease the resistance of the rheostat by sliding its contact. Step 2: Obtain five different current values () by adjusting the rheostat.
(viii) Read and record and the corresponding voltmeter reading where . Step 1: For each of the five current values obtained in step (vii), read and record the ammeter reading () and the corresponding voltmeter reading ().
(ix) Replace the wire A with wire B as shown in Fig. 3(b). Step 1: Open the key and carefully disconnect wire A from the circuit. Step 2: Connect wire B into the circuit in the same position where wire A was, ensuring the voltmeter is still in parallel across wire B.
(x) Repeat the procedure from (iv) – (viii). Step 1: Close the key. Step 2: Adjust the rheostat to obtain the minimum current and record and . Step 3: Adjust the rheostat to obtain five other current values () and their corresponding voltage values ().
(xi) In each case, read and record , , and . Step 1: This step is covered by repeating (iv)-(viii) for wire B. All current and voltage readings for wire B should be recorded.
(xii) Tabulate the results. Step 1: Create a table with columns for Current (), Voltage (), Current (), and Voltage (). Step 2: Populate the table with all the recorded values for and .
(xiii) Plot a graph of on the vertical axis and on the horizontal axis. Step 1: Draw a graph with the vertical axis labeled (Volts) and the horizontal axis labeled (Amperes). Step 2: Plot the data points from your table. Step 3: Draw the best-fit straight line through the plotted points.
(xiv) Determine the slope of the graph. Step 1: Choose two distinct points and on the best-fit line. Step 2: Calculate the slope using the formula: The slope represents the resistance of wire A.
(xv) On the same axes, plot on the vertical axis and on the horizontal axis. Step 1: Using the same graph axes as in (xiii), plot the data points from your table. Step 2: Draw the best-fit straight line through these new points. This line will represent the behavior of wire B.
